The Dirt Worshippers Ball: Mother Grove Celebrates Harvest HomeOn Saturday, September 19, Mother Grove Goddess Temple invites you to come on along home. We’ll be celebrating at West Asheville Park, near the picnic shelter, beginning at 3. The afternoon concludes with a potluck feast following the ritual.
We extend an especially warm welcome to all those who have attended our events in the past and whom we haven’t seen lately. We’d love to see you “home” for the harvest.
Mother Grove is a spiritual community that celebrates the ancient holy days and honors the Divine as Female. All respectful people are welcome to attend our public events. We ask that you bring your own feast gear (plate, utensils and cup) and a dish to share when we break bread together.
You may also make a contribution to our food pantry (non-perishable foods, please) and get more information about the temple and its activities. A love offering is also very welcome to cover the expenses of our work for and in the community.
